Yekaterinburg vs Bhubaneshwar Climate & Distance Between

India flag
  • The distance between Yekaterinburg, Russia and Bhubaneshwar, India is approximately 4,562 km or 2,835 mi.
  • To reach Yekaterinburg in this distance one would set out from Bhubaneshwar bearing 339.2°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Yekaterinburg bearing 322.5° or NW .
  • Yekaterinburg has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Bhubaneshwar has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Yekaterinburg is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Bhubaneshwar is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 26.5 °C (47.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 23.3 °C (41.9°F) more in Yekaterinburg.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1032 mm (40.6 in) less which is equivalent to 1032 l/m² (25.33 US gal/ft²) or 10,320,000 l/ha (1,103,276 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 35.7° lower in Yekaterinburg than in Bhubaneshwar.
  • Relative humidity levels are 1.8%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 25°C (44.9°F) lower.
